我的目录如下(此处未列出正确的__init__.py
文件):
root
package1/
subpackage1/
submodule1.py
module1.py
package2/
module2.py
docs/
正在运行sphinx-apidoc . --full -o docs -H 'MyProject' -A 'MyName' -V '1.0'
我几乎得到了我需要的一切:
index.rst
package1.rst
package1.subpackage1.rst
package2.rst
index
列出了package1
和package2
,但 package1
未列出package1.subpackage1
。
我不想手动编辑package1.rst
,因为它无法针对大型项目进行扩展,无法手动列出每个子包。